ST IVES CRIME UPDATE

3rd November 2006

ST IVES

 

 

Dwelling Burglary

 

 

29/10/06 14:00-19:19

Waveney Road

Beading removed from two ground floor windows to rear with unknown tool. Entry not gained.

25/10/01/11/06

Constable Road

Unknown offenders have used a jemmy to patio door, entry gained, items stolen.

 

 

 

Non Dwelling Burglary

 

 

 

 

 

28-30/10/06

Harding Way

Offender gained entry to compound, kicked in bottom glass panel of rear door to gain entry, rifled through drawers and taken keys to 6 vehicles, vehicles taken from compound, gates left open.

 

 

 

Criminal Damage

 

 

26-27/10/06

Chelmer Close

Aerial ripped off Peugeot 206.

27-30/10/06

The Pavement

Unknown offender has damaged front door window of shop.

28-30/10/06

Parkway

Kia Carens keyed along nearside of vehicle.

30-31/10/06

Elm Drive

Unknown offenders have damaged plastic chain fencing at front of garden and stolen it.

30-31/10/06

Morland Way

Silver Citroen keyed from passenger door to rear.

31/10/06-02/11/06

Stephenson Road

Roof damaged on Ford Ka, looks as though offender has banged on roof with fist.

31/10-02/11/06

Tenterleas

Eggs thrown at Jaguar causing damage to paintwork.

 

 

 

Theft from vehicle

 

29-30/10/06

Alwyn Close

Door forced to gain entry to Citroen Saxo Stereo stolen.

 

 

 

BLUNTISHAM

 

 

Non Dwelling Burglary

 

 

25-27/10/06

Station Road

Unknown person has gained entry to locked port cabin by smashing the lower half of wooden door. Nothing stolen

 

 

 

Dwelling Burglary

 

 

30/10/06 10:00-15:47

Mill Lane

Blunt instrument used to try to gain entry, attempts made to patio door, side patio door, small and large windows at rear.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

COLNE

 

 

Non Dwelling Burglary

 

 

26-27/10/06

Holme Fen Drove

Compactor stolen from yard at rear of buildings.

 

 

 

FENSTANTON

 

 

Criminal Damage

 

 

01-02/11/06

Dove Close

Side front window of Peugeot smashed.

 

 

 

Non Dwelling Burglary

 

 

01-02/11/06

Simmer Piece

Padlock forced off garden shed to gain entry, hedge trimmer stolen

 

 

 

HILTON

 

 

Non Dwelling Burglary

 

 

27-30/10/06

Church Lane

Lightening Conductor consisting of copper cable pulled off exterior of church and stolen.

 

 

 

NEEDINGWORTH

 

 

 

Criminal Damage

 

 

27/10/06 00:05-11:18

Silver Lane

Aggrieved woken in night by noise in garden saw a male jump over fence, offender disturbed the wheelie bin, he saw he was being watched and attempted to pull himself over wall and in doing so damaged coping stones.

 

 

 

SOMERSHAM

 

 

Non dwelling Burglary

 

 

29-30/10/06

Chatteris Road

Padlock hasp cut off with hacksaw to gain entry to workshop. Hack sawed padlock hasp off fuel compound and started tractor unit to try to force gate open from inside, Nothing taken.

 

 

 

WYTON

 

 

Theft of vehicle

 

 

30/10/06 01:00-08:21

Sawtry Way

Offenders entered forecourt, broke into white Mitsubishi Evolution by breaking rear quarter light, damaged steering wheel. The broke rear quarter light of Silver Mitsubishi, tried to start it, took battery & index plates from white vehicle and placed on silver one and drove off with vehicle.8
